For this week’s #GuildChat Frank Nguyen suggested we explore the ideas and efforts at Personalized learning. What is this? Does it truly exist yet and what value will it bring at what costs? Can we every really have truly personalized learning or is this the latest buzz with the emergence of AI? We work every angle of a topic that crosses technology, psychology and even physiology in learning

Join us this week as the community discusses Personalized Learning and if and how it can be realized.

Prospective questions:

Q1 What Does Personalized Learning look like to you? Give an example perhaps? #GuildChat
Q2 Does simply giving people choice in their learning experiences count as personalization? Why or why not? #GuildChat
Q3 Netflix is often pointed to as a model for things like adaptive or personalized learning. What’s right or wrong with this? #GuildChat
Q4 Are there levels of personalization? If so, what might level 1 (simple) look like vs say level 5 (more complex)? #GuildChat
Q5 Does every kind of learning experience benefit from being personalized? Why or why not? #GuildChat
Q6 What emerging technologies do you expect to better enable personalized learning over the next few years? How so? #GuildChat
Q7 What are some ways we can use the kinds of data we collect today to better inform personalized learning? #GuildChat
Q8 How can learning professionals prepare for a role in personalized learning approaches? #GuildChat
